Lemon Garlic Salmon Orzo

Ingredients For the Salmon
- 4 salmon fillets (about 6 oz each)
- 2 tbsp extra virgin olive oil
- 1 tsp paprika
- 1 tsp garlic powder
- ½ tsp dried oregano
- Salt, to taste
- Freshly ground black pepper, to taste
For the Orzo
- 1 cup uncooked orzo pasta
- 3 garlic cloves, minced
- 2 tbsp unsalted butter
- 2½ cups low-sodium chicken broth
- 1 cup baby spinach
- ½ cup freshly grated Parmesan cheese
- Juice of 1 large lemon
- 1 tsp lemon zest
- 1 tbsp chopped fresh parsley
Optional Garnishes
- Lemon slices
- Extra Parmesan cheese
- Fresh dill
- Cracked black pepper
Instructions
- Pat the salmon fillets dry with paper towels.
- Season both sides with paprika, garlic powder, oregano, salt, and black pepper.
- Heat the ol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at.
- Sear the salmon for 3–4 minutes per side, depending on thickness, until golden and cooked through. Transfer to a plate.
- Reduce the heat to medium and melt the butter in the same skillet.
- Add the minced garlic and cook for about 30 seconds until fragrant.
- Stir in the uncooked orzo and toast for 1–2 minutes.
- Pour in the chicken broth and stir well.
- Bring to a gentle simmer, then reduce the heat to low.
- Cook for 10–12 minutes, stirring occasionally, until the orzo is tender and most of the liquid has been absorbed.
- Stir in the spinach and cook until wilted.
- Add the Parmesan cheese, lemon juice, lemon zest, and parsley. Stir until creamy.
- Taste and adjust the seasoning with additional salt and pepper if needed.
- Return the salmon to the skillet and let it warm for 1–2 minutes.
- Garnish with fresh parsley, lemon slices, and extra Parmesan before serving.
Tips
- Choose center-cut salmon fillets for even cooking.
- Do not overcook the salmon—it should flake easily while remaining moist.
- Freshly grated Parmesan melts more smoothly than pre-shredded cheese.
- Add asparagus, peas, or broccoli for extra vegetables.
- A pinch of crushed red pepper flakes adds gentle heat.
- Use freshly squeezed lemon juice for the brightest flavor.
- Serve immediately while the orzo is creamy.
Notes
-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
- Reheat gently with a splash of chicken broth or milk to restore the creamy texture.
- Freezing is not recommended because the orzo may become soft after thawing.
- This recipe can also be made with shrimp or chicken instead of salmon.
Q&A
Can I use frozen salmon?
Yes. Thaw it completely and pat it dry before seasoning and cooking.
Can I make this recipe gluten-free?
Yes. Replace the orzo with your favorite gluten-free pasta or cooked rice.
Can I substitute kale for spinach?
Absolutely. Kale works well but may need a few extra minutes to soften.
What should I serve with Lemon Garlic Salmon Orzo?
It pairs beautifully with roasted asparagus, steamed broccoli, Mediterranean cucumber salad, garlic bread, roasted Brussels sprouts, or a simple green salad.
